The Relationship between Structure and Photo-Fenton CatalyticAbility of Iron-containing Aluminosilicate Glass prepared by Sol-gel method
The aim of this work is the development of an effective treatment of wastewater polluted with organic compounds by green chemical techniques. Glasses and ceramics with photocatalytic properties could be applied for the decomposition of organic materials in contaminated wastewater. Hematite (α-Fe2O3) is a suitable material, due to its photocatalytic properties and low band gap energy [1]. In our previous study, precipitated α-Fe2O3 could be detected from the ~(57)Fe-Mossbauer spectra of iron-containing silicate glass prepared by the sol-gel method [2] and melt-quenching method [3]. It showed a high rate constant of 2.87×10- 2 h- 1 [3] for methylene blue (MB) decomposition under visible light.
